Luis Milla, the heartbeat of Getafe CF, stands at a pivotal crossroads in his football career. Despite showcasing undeniable talent and top-notch performances at the Coliseum, the coveted dream of donning the Spanish national team jersey feels increasingly distant. The 30-year-old midfielder must now grapple with a daunting choice: remain a cornerstone for Getafe or venture to a more prominent club that might elevate his visibility on the international stage.
Milla has emerged as a standout star for Getafe, masterfully orchestrating plays from the center of the field. His ability to balance the game and read opponents has earned him multiple nominations for Player of the Month, solidifying his status as an indispensable part of José Bordalás’ tactical setup. The field comes alive when he’s in control.
However, the fierce competition for midfield spots in the Spanish team looms large. Unfortunately, being with a club that doesn’t attract as much media attention limits Milla’s exposure, making it harder for him to catch the eye of national coach Luis de la Fuente. Many speculate that to fulfill his dream of representing La Roja, Milla needs a stage where he can shine brighter—like with a team competing in high-stakes tournaments.
As he reflects on his future, this talented playmaker faces a tough reality. Stay with the strong, yet quieter Getafe or chase a new challenge that could unlock the door to international glory. One thing is clear: Milla’s journey is just beginning, and every choice could lead him closer to—or further from—the ultimate showdown wearing Spain’s colors.
